Outcome

We held a ten week consultation from 5 October to 14 December 2022 to find out what good housing means to local people. This information was used to decide if we need a selective licensing scheme in Moss Side and Whalley Range. Read more about selective licensing

After reviewing comments from landlords and residents, we have decided to formally designate a selective licensing area around Claremont Road / Great Western Street in Moss Side and Whalley Range. This means that landlords and managing agents in specific parts of Moss Side and Whalley Range will need a licence to rent out a home. If you are a landlord in the area, you have up to 9th May 2023 to apply for a licence

The scheme aims to improve management standards and conditions of private rented housing and support the reduction of antisocial behaviour. For now, we are focusing on some parts of Moss Side and Whalley Range. The Claremont Road / Great Western Street area includes around 346 private sector homes.
